Output 05fc2423fc04804b582fb1a9a6ee1d0c23b0a968c39cfd286eaba380711f2579:1

value
131798555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 973faee5bafdea74c22638a32b106191c0f3011e OP_EQUAL
address
MMgtZBXqNfyKSuuQPH9DahWQU37cchjwiA
transaction
05fc2423fc04804b582fb1a9a6ee1d0c23b0a968c39cfd286eaba380711f2579
spent
true